          Does the computer just turn off? or does it give you an error message first? Also, you should try booting up from a live cd/usb like Parted Magic ( http://partedmagic.com/ ) if it turns off then you know there is some sort of hardware problem. If not... then it's something windows related. I'd recommend parted magic because you don't need any linux/unix experience to run it... I don't know if that is an issue for you.

              Sounds like a Windows being retarded issue. Try uninstalling recent updates, games, programs and see what happens. Could also be a hard drive starting to go, video card overheating, or power supply starting to go. If removing recent installs doesn't work, I'd open her up while she runs and make sure that the fan on the video card is spinning, no stalls. Download a hard drive diagnostic tool and run that. Power supply, unless you have a multimeter lying around and know which pins to jump, the only really good way to test is to swap it out for a known good working power supply. You can also always reinstall Windows.
